Tour Overview

The article provides an overview of the Scavenger Hunt Berlin Prenzlauer Berg, an independent city tour activity in Berlin, Germany.

The tour is a game-like scavenger hunt that takes place in the Prenzlauer Berg neighborhood. Priced at $48.49 for up to 10 participants, the tour includes a scavenger hunt box with puzzles, directions, and cards in German.

Participants are responsible for their own transportation, entry fees, food, and drinks. The meeting point is the Ernst-Thälmann-Denkmal, and the tour ends at Rykebahn.

The tour is available daily from 8 AM to 7 PM, but the starting time must be confirmed with the local provider. The activity isn’t wheelchair accessible but is stroller-friendly, and service animals are allowed.

Meeting and End Points

City Game Scavenger Hunt Berlin Prenzlauer Berg - Independent City Tour - Meeting and End Points

According to the information provided, the meeting point for the Scavenger Hunt Berlin Prenzlauer Berg is the Ernst-Thälmann-Denkmal, located at Greifswalder Str. 52, 10405 Berlin, Germany.

Once the scavenger hunt is completed, the end point is Rykestrase 1, 10405 Berlin, Germany.

The tour is an independent city game, so you will explore the Prenzlauer Berg neighborhood of Berlin on their own using the provided scavenger hunt materials.

The meeting and end points are easily accessible, though the tour isn’t wheelchair accessible.
